The importance of health screenings:

Health screenings offer a number of advantages, which make them invaluable for maintaining overall well-being.

Firstly, they can help to detect any underlying medical conditions or issues before they cause serious harm. Early detection is key when it comes to treating many illnesses and can save both time and money in the long run.

Secondly, they allow doctors to gauge an individual’s overall health. This can help them to advise on any lifestyle changes, medication or other treatments that may be necessary.

Thirdly, they provide a form of preventative care because they allow doctors to look at an individual’s risk factors and advise accordingly. This could include advice on diet, exercise and more – all of which can help to keep you healthy in the long term.

Advice for going for health screenings:

When it comes to health screenings, there are a few tips that you should keep in mind:

1) Find a reputable healthcare provider:

Choosing a qualified healthcare provider for your health screening is critical. With the right professional on board, you can gain a reliable and accurate insight into your current condition while benefiting from well-informed advice tailored to meet your individual needs. Make sure they have adequate qualifications and experience in order to ensure an optimal evaluation of any potential risks.

2) Listen to your doctor:

Your doctor knows your unique health profile, so it’s wise to heed their advice about medical screenings. They can help protect you and those closest to you.

3) Make sure everyone in the family is checked:

Family health is vital, and regular screenings allow doctors to catch any potential problems before they become serious. Through these checkups, physicians can also give personalised advice tailored specifically to each member of the family for a healthier lifestyle.

4) Take note of follow-up care:

Protecting your health is more than just a one-time effort – it’s an ongoing process that requires regular checkups and lifestyle changes. After getting screened, take the steps necessary to stay ahead of any hidden medical issues or potential risks.
